Sir Ben Ainslie is the world’s most successful Olympic sailor with four gold and one silver medal to his name. His first two medals were in the Laser class. After winning gold in Sydney he wrote this book which remains his only how-to book. After that he won 3 more gold medals in the Finn class. He has been World Sailor of the Year four times. He was knighted in 2012 and was the winning tactician in the 2013 America’s Cup.
